Well a friend of mine drove down from Alabama last week to visit for a bit and brought me the pipe rack he has been working on for me. It is solid maple put together with dowels so no screw marks anywhere. He was able to wood burn my White Tree of Gondor tattoo/symbol into the top. I love it, just going to have to widen a couple of the slots to accommodate some of my fatter pipe stems like the Baronet that is turned sideways in the pic.
